* Evaluate model using a dataset object. * * Note: Unlike `evaluate()`, this method is asynchronous (`async`). * * @param dataset A dataset object. Its `iterator()` method is expected * to generate a dataset iterator object, the `next()` method of which * is expected to produce
(dataset: Dataset<{}>, args?: ModelEvaluateDatasetArgs)
| 886 | * @doc {heading: 'Models', subheading: 'Classes'} |
| 887 | */ |
| 888 | async evaluateDataset(dataset: Dataset<{}>, args?: ModelEvaluateDatasetArgs): |
| 889 | Promise<Scalar|Scalar[]> { |
| 890 | this.makeTestFunction(); |
| 891 | return evaluateDataset(this, dataset, args); |
| 892 | } |
| 893 | |
| 894 | /** |
| 895 | * Get number of samples provided for training, evaluation or prediction. |
no test coverage detected